Can you explain how Sai Baba fostered unity between Hindus and Muslims through the celebration of their respective festivals?

πŸ“– Chapter 7

Chapter 7 illustrates Sai Baba's impartial and equal love for both Hindu and Muslim communities by describing how he managed their festivals. For the Hindu festival of Ram Navami, Baba himself would arrange for a cradle to be tied, along with Katha and Kirtan performances. Remarkably, on the very same night, he would grant permission for the Muslim Sandal procession. The text explicitly states he conducted both festivals with equal joy. Similarly, he facilitated the preparation of Gopal-Kala for Gokul Ashtami and ensured there were no obstacles to Namaj prayers during Eid, demonstrating his role as a unifier.
